Did you download the file first to your local computer and then try
uploading it to Workbench? Workbench cannot point directly to a remote
file location -- although that would be an interesting feature, if
there was a big enough use case.

I may be having the same issue. When I download from the link in the tutorial, it becomes a decompressed file on the Mac. I re-compressed it, and was able to choose the file, but Workbench reports that it cannot find package.xml. Package.xml is definitely there, so I'm not sure what the issue is.
